How they compare
Poland currently reports 10,504 kt against 8,564 kt in Australia and New Zealand, a difference of 1,940 kt.
That makes Poland's figure about 1.2 times Australia and New Zealand's.
Across all 34 years both countries report, Poland has been ahead every year.
Australia and New Zealand ranks 12th and Poland ranks 10th of 144 countries.
Poland has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Australia and New Zealand | Poland |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 5,082 kt | 18,449 kt | 13,367 kt | Poland |
| 2000s | 7,311 kt | 14,849 kt | 7,538 kt | Poland |
| 2010s | 8,061 kt | 13,342 kt | 5,282 kt | Poland |
| 2020s | 8,378 kt | 11,715 kt | 3,336 kt | Poland |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
